The incorporation of nanocarbons in hierarchical composites can also result in large improvements in their electrical conductivity, and to a lesser extent in their thermal conductivity. For ceramic fibers both in-plane and out-of-plane electrical conductivities are increased by several orders of magnitude [41], whereas for CF the improvement is significant only perpendicular to the fiber direction due to the already high conductivity of the fiber itself [46]. The out-of-plane electrical conductivity of CNT/CF/epoxy composites is approaching the requirements for lightning strike protection in aerospace composites, thought to be around 1 10 S/m. Yet further improvements are required, as well as the evaluation of other composite properties relevant for this application, such as maximum current density and thermal conductivity. [Pg.238]

When equipment is exposed to direct lightning strikes Equipment connected directly to an overhead line, or even through a transformer, will fall into this category. Select the highest value of BIL and even then a surge protection will become necessary for critical installations. [Pg.596]

When equipment is shielded This is when it is installed indoors, like a generator or motor. Now it may be subject to only attenuated surges. One may now select a lower value of BIL. In most cases surge protection may not be essential for direct lightning strikes. [Pg.596]

These are only basic guidelines. It is difficult to define exposed or shielded equipment accurately. Equipment installed indoors may never be subject to lightning strikes or their transferences, but may be exposed to severe switching surges and require surge protection as for an exposed installation. A fault current-limiter is a component which protects power transmission and distribution systems from surges caused by, for example, a lightning strike, fulfilling a function similar to that of a varistor (see Section 4.3.1). The limiter should be capable of reducing the fault current to a fraction of its peak value in less than a cycle. Because for this application the requirement is for low Jc, fault current limiters are already a commercial product. In the case of the lead shown in Fig. 4.58(b) the fault current is limited to a safe value within 5 ms of the arrival of the current spike . [Pg.229]
